WebJun 20, 2024 · Buying a variety that's suited to your area's temperature really helps the grass seed germinate. You can even look for special varieties designed for sun-, shade-, or … WebJun 8, 2024 · Sow the seed at the recommended rate for your grass type. You can use a seed spreader to make sure the seed is evenly distributed. Water regularly. Grass needs water to grow, so make sure you keep the soil moist but not soggy. Water in the morning so the grass has time to dry out before nightfall. lake apopka ad https://boissonsdesiles.com

WebJul 4, 2024 · Grass seed needs to stay consistently moist to germinate, and spreading hay over the area helps hold in moisture without letting the ground get too wet, which could make the seeds moldy. The hay helps hold the newly turned soil in place, preventing erosion so the seeds stay contact with the soil. Apply a seed starter fertilizer … WebScarification, or the process of piercing the seed’s shell, can help speed up the germination process by allowing water to enter the seed. Nicking the seeds should be done immediately before planting. Larger seeds can be pierced using a small knife. Wear gloves, and be careful during the process.

WebMar 27, 2024 · To plant your grass seeds through regular planting, begin by preparing the soil: Loosen the top two to three inches of soil, and then dig six inches deep to remove … WebJun 2, 2024 · Water the seeds. Set your garden hose head to the "mist" setting and lightly water the seeds until it is thoroughly damp. For a larger lawn, run a sprinkler in the center of the area for a few minutes.
